The Ossa Phantom 125 was a Air Cooled, Single Cylinder, 2 Stroke Enduro motorcycle produced by Ossa in 1975. Claimed horsepower was 21.05 HP (15.7 KW) @ 8500 RPM.
Engine
A 53.8mm bore x 53.8mm stroke result in a displacement of just 123.0 cubic centimeters.
Drive
The bike has a 5 Speed transmission.
Chassis
It came with a 3.00-21 front tire and a 4.00-18 rear tire. Stopping was achieved via Drum in the front and a Drum in the rear. The wheelbase was 54.49 inches (1384 mm) long.
